What Is an RV Charger and How Does It Work?

An RV charger, also known as an RV converter or power converter, is a device designed to convert 120V AC power from a campground or shore power into 12V DC power. This conversion is essential for powering the electrical systems within the RV, including lights, water pumps, and appliances when not connected to an external power source or when the RV battery needs to be charged.

How It Works:

  • AC to DC Conversion: The RV charger takes the alternating current (AC) from an electrical outlet and transforms it into direct current (DC), which is compatible with the RV’s battery and electrical system.
  • Battery Charging: When connected to an external power source, the charger ensures the battery is charged efficiently while also supplying power to the RV’s electrical systems.
  • Smart Technology: Many modern RV chargers include smart technology that adjusts the charging rate based on the battery’s state of charge, optimizing the charging process and extending battery life.

RV chargers come in different types, including:
Standard RV Chargers: Basic models that provide essential charging functions.
Smart Chargers: Advanced units that offer features like multi-stage charging and temperature monitoring.
Solar Chargers: Designed to harness solar energy for charging batteries, ideal for off-grid camping.

Understanding how RV chargers function is crucial for maintaining a reliable power supply for your recreational vehicle.

What Types of RV Chargers Are Available on the Market?

There are several types of RV chargers available on the market, each designed for specific charging needs and preferences.

  • Converter/Charger: A converter/charger is a device that converts 120V AC power from an electrical outlet into 12V DC power to charge the RV’s battery. This type is essential for maintaining battery health when connected to shore power, as it can simultaneously power appliances and charge the batteries.
  • Solar Chargers: Solar chargers utilize solar panels to convert sunlight into electricity, which is then used to charge the RV batteries. This eco-friendly option is especially useful for boondocking, as it allows RV owners to harness renewable energy while minimizing their reliance on traditional power sources.
  • Battery Maintainers: Battery maintainers are designed to keep a battery charged at an optimal level without overcharging it. These devices are ideal for long-term storage, as they prevent sulfation and extend the life of the battery by providing a slow trickle charge.
  • Inverter/Charger: An inverter/charger combines the functions of an inverter, which converts DC power to AC power, and a charger that replenishes the batteries. This versatile unit allows RV owners to run AC appliances while also keeping the batteries charged, making it a great all-in-one solution for off-grid camping.
  • Smart Chargers: Smart chargers are advanced devices that automatically adjust their output based on the battery’s state of charge. They often include features such as temperature compensation and multi-stage charging, which optimize battery health and efficiency, making them a preferred choice for serious RV enthusiasts.

What Common Issues Might You Encounter with RV Chargers?

Common issues encountered with RV chargers can affect their efficiency and reliability.

  • Overheating: Overheating can occur due to prolonged use or inadequate ventilation, which may lead to reduced performance or even damage to the charger. It’s essential to ensure that the charger is installed in a well-ventilated area to prevent heat buildup.
  • Incompatibility: Some RV chargers may not be compatible with certain battery types or voltage systems, leading to improper charging. Always check the specifications of both the charger and the battery to ensure they can work together effectively.
  • Battery Management Issues: Poor battery management can result in overcharging or undercharging, which can shorten battery life. Using chargers with built-in management systems can help maintain optimal charging levels and prolong battery health.
  • Connection Problems: Loose or corroded connections can disrupt the charging process, leading to inefficiencies. Regularly inspect and clean connections to ensure a solid and secure link between the charger and the batteries.
  • Faulty Components: Components within the charger, such as fuses or diodes, can fail over time, leading to a complete charger malfunction. Regular maintenance and inspections can help identify and replace faulty parts before they cause significant issues.
  • Environmental Factors: Extreme weather conditions, such as excessive heat or cold, can impact the performance of RV chargers. Choosing chargers designed to withstand various environmental conditions can help mitigate these risks.

What Are the Leading Brands for RV Chargers?

The leading brands for RV chargers are:

  • Victron Energy: Known for high-quality and reliable products, Victron Energy offers a range of RV chargers that are efficient and user-friendly. Their MultiPlus and Blue Smart series provide advanced features such as Bluetooth connectivity and smart charging capabilities, making them ideal for modern RV applications.
  • Renogy: A popular choice among RV enthusiasts, Renogy specializes in solar power solutions and offers versatile chargers that can integrate seamlessly with solar panels. Their products often come with built-in protections against overcharging and short circuits, ensuring safety and longevity.
  • Progressive Dynamics: Renowned for their power management systems, Progressive Dynamics manufactures high-quality RV converters and chargers that are designed for durability. Their products typically feature built-in charge wizards that automatically adjust charging rates based on the battery’s state, optimizing battery health.
  • NOCO: NOCO is well-regarded for its compact and portable battery chargers, making them perfect for RV owners who need something lightweight and efficient. Their Genius series includes smart technology that can diagnose battery issues and adjust charging parameters accordingly for enhanced performance.
  • Magnum Energy: This brand provides a variety of robust RV inverter/charger systems, ideal for off-grid RV setups. Magnum chargers are known for their high efficiency and ability to handle heavy loads, making them suitable for users with extensive power needs.
